What is python3-pkgconfig
python3-pkgconfig is:
pkgconfig is a Python module to interface with the pkg-config command line tool and supports Python 3 It cabe used to: -Check if a package exists -Check if a package meets certain version requirements -Query CFLAGS and LDFLAGS -Parse the output to build extensions with setup.py

Install python3-pkgconfig Using apt-get
Update apt database with apt-get
using the following command.
sudo apt-get update
After updating apt database, We can install python3-pkgconfig
using apt-get
by running the following command:
sudo apt-get -y install python3-pkgconfig

How To Uninstall python3-pkgconfig on Debian 11
To uninstall only the python3-pkgconfig
package we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get remove python3-pkgconfig
Uninstall python3-pkgconfig And Its Dependencies
To uninstall python3-pkgconfig
and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Debian 11, we can use the command below:
sudo apt-get -y autoremove python3-pkgconfig
Remove python3-pkgconfig Configurations and Data
To remove python3-pkgconfig
configuration and data from Debian 11 we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get -y purge python3-pkgconfig
Remove python3-pkgconfig configuration, data, and all of its dependencies
We can use the following command to remove python3-pkgconfig
config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ge python3-pkgconfig
